    David Charles Goelz (/ ˈ ɡ oʊ l z /; born July 16, 1946) is an American puppeteer, puppet builder and actor, known for his work with the Muppets. As part of the Muppets' performing cast, Goelz performs Gonzo the Great, as well as Dr. Bunsen Honeydew, Waldorf (after Jim Henson's death), Zoot and Beauregard, originating on The Muppet Show.
